Checking the ignition timing angle (Mitsubishi Lancer 9)

1. Before starting the inspection procedure, prepare the vehicle (see section "Checking the idle speed").

2. Turn off the ignition and connect the tester to the 16-pin diagnostic connector under the instrument panel.



3. Install the strobe light.

Note: For GDI engine, connect the timing light to the ignition coil power line of cylinder #1 (terminal "1").




GDI engine.


4. Start the engine and let it idle.

5. Check that the idle speed corresponds to the nominal value (see section "Checking the idle speed").

6. Select the settings on the tester (subparagraph No.17 of the Actuator test item for MUT-II) corresponding to the setting of the basic ignition timing angle.

Note: For GDI engine, at this point the engine speed will be 700 rpm (4G15) or 750 rpm (4G93).




7. Check the value of the base ignition advance angle, which should be within the specified limits.

Nominal value...5+3°before TDC 8. If the basic ignition timing angle does not correspond to the nominal value, then perform troubleshooting and check the fuel injection system components (see the relevant chapter).

9. Press the reset button on the tester (the "Clear" button for MUT-II) to disable the basic advance angle mode (Actuator Test mode for MUT-II). Note: if this is not done, the forced control mode of the device will be maintained for 27 minutes. Driving the car under these conditions may cause engine damage.

10. Check that the ignition timing angle corresponds to the nominal value.

Nominal value: (approximately)
  • GDI Engine - 20° BTDC
  • Engine 4G15-MPI - 10° BTDC
  • Engine 4G93-MPI - 8° BTDC

Note:
  • Even under normal engine operation, the ignition timing angle varies within ±7°.
  • As the altitude increases, the ignition timing angle is automatically increased by approximately 5° from the nominal value.
  • For a GDI engine, after 4 minutes or more after the base advance mode is turned off, the spark advance angle will be approximately 5° BTDC.


11. Disconnect the strobe light.

12. Turn off the ignition and disconnect the tester.
